Kevin 'forever grateful' to donor's family following heart transplant
A Scot who received a new heart from a donor whose organs saved four lives following his tragic death has says he is thankful for the “amazing gift”.
Kevin Brogan experienced an unexpected heart attack in early 2023.
That led to him being under the care of the Scottish National Advanced Heart Failure Service for three months as doctors battled to revive his deteriorating heart.
Eventually, he was hit with the devastating news that he would eventually need a heart transplant.
The heart of young Glaswegian, James Alexander Borland, was identified as a match.
Tragically, James had passed away at the tender age of just 25.
A year after James's death, his grieving mother Audrey Cameron, 58, attended The Order of St John Award ceremony for donor families.
Through NHS Blood and Transplant's anonymous letter system, she received messages from two recipients whose lives were saved by James's organs.
One of these recipients was Kevin from Stirling.
Today, four men continue to live due to receiving the donated organs - including a man who underwent a double lung transplant and two others who each received a kidney.
